Output 908313cea8b230958e1b1672afbf20df215d8d39bd19c98f55d89e6e01395bad:0

value
3120289
script pubkey
OP_0 OP_PUSHBYTES_20 bc66922695d5ff2e8b687ff958a5bb3b095d6a1c
address
bc1qh3nfyf546hljazmg0lu43fdm8vy466sun8lplj
transaction
908313cea8b230958e1b1672afbf20df215d8d39bd19c98f55d89e6e01395bad
confirmations
130958
spent
true